Probable depression is prevalent among parents and primary caregivers of children with specific learning disorders in Saudi Arabia, and machine-learning models can predict it with high accuracy.
The study found that 35.6% of 612 caregivers met criteria for probable depression (PHQ-9 ≥ 10). XGBoost achieved an ROC AUC of 0.916, sensitivity of 0.858, and specificity of 0.830 at a screening threshold of 0.425, with key predictors including parenting stress, anxiety, sleep quality, and child difficulties.

Limitations
- ⚠Cross-sectional design prevents causal inference
- ⚠Sample recruited through service and community pathways may not be representative of all caregivers in Saudi Arabia
- ⚠External validation of machine-learning models is required before clinical implementation
Frequently Asked Questions
What is the prevalence of probable depression among caregivers of children with SLDs in Saudi Arabia?▼
The study found a prevalence of 35.6% (95% CI 31.8-39.6) among 612 caregivers, based on a PHQ-9 score of 10 or higher.
Which machine-learning model performed best for predicting caregiver depression?▼
XGBoost and the soft-voting ensemble achieved the highest ROC AUC of 0.916. XGBoost had an average precision of 0.867 and a Brier score of 0.115.
What are the top predictors of probable depression in these caregivers?▼
Key predictors identified by SHAP analysis include parenting stress, parental anxiety symptoms, sleep quality, SLD severity, child emotional and behavioral difficulties, perceived social support, and coping capacity.
Can these models be used in clinical practice now?▼
No, the authors state that external evaluation is required before implementation, as the models were developed on a specific sample and need validation in other populations.
